I do believe there is value in the second round.    One of the value positions I see is the center position.   They tend to fall a little on draft day in today's game...especially when they are upperclassmen.   I will have some wing names that I like, but here are the centers I like.   Some of these guys I would want to buy a pick on and the others are undrafted guys.    I am not saying they will go undrafted, but if they do go undrafted I would have an interest in them as an UDFA.

I would prefer a rim running center, but there are a few guys who provide different skills who interest me.  

For most of these guys I have only seen highlights so it is really tricky to go all in on these guys.  


1) Charles Bassey-   I see an athletic rim runner.    He played college ball for three years but he looks the part.   I would buy a pick for him in he was there in the mid second.

2) Neemias Queta-  Another guy who is an athletic big.  He provides better passing than Bassey.   I would also buy a pick for him as well.  

3)  Jericho Sims-  He was a guy I highlighted a while ago when it looked like he would not be drafted.  Since then he has had a nice offseason and appears to be a draftable player now.   He is really athletic and I think has some untapped upside despite being a senior.  Not sure I would buy a pick for him, but he is definitely a name to watch.

4)  Isaiah Todd-  I expect some team to gamble on his youth plus skill in the early second.   He would be hard to get to that range.  If he fell into the mid 40's though, he would definitely be high on my list.  

5) Sandro Mamukelashvili-  He has a really unique game.  He is a fabulous passer and does not look or move like a guy who is 6'11".   He has the name but if he played in some second division german league, he would probably go 15-20 picks higher.  He would be an UDFA target of mine.

6)  Luke Garza-  I have real doubts if he is an NBA player.   Although he would be fun to watch play in the G-League.  He can really shoot and would really be a handful in the post and on the boards if he got a smaller player on him.  Defense is where I have not idea how he makes it.   But he has gotten slimmer this offseason and maybe he finds a role.   He would be an UDFA for me.  

I think with todays game at least three of these guys goes undrafted.  The top 4 on my list probably gets drafted, but maybe one slips due to age.

Quote:The Sixers have had discussions about moving the No. 28 pick in the 2021 NBA draft and are open to trading that selection in a deal for future assets or a veteran contributor, writes Keith Pompey of The Philadelphia Inquirer.

Kyle Neubeck of PhillyVoice.com, who first reported that the 76ers were exploring trading their first-round selection, hears from a source that there’s a “very good chance” the pick is on the move on or before draft night. Philadelphia’s goal, Neubeck notes, is to add another starter-level player to its rotation, so even if the team trades No. 28 for future assets, it may look to flip those assets for a veteran.

Although the Sixers could be a taxpayer in 2021/22 and the No. 28 pick would give them the opportunity to add an inexpensive young player to the roster, the team feels it doesn’t have a ton of extra “developmental reps” to offer, says Neubeck. Tyrese Maxey, Matisse Thybulle, Paul Reed, and Isaiah Joe are among the young players who will be competing for rotation minutes next season.

Still, the 76ers continue to take a closer look at players who could be options at No. 28, in case they hang onto the pick. Pompey reports that Arizona State wing Josh Christopher, who ranks 33rd on ESPN’s big board, recently visited and worked out for the team.

If the Sixers do move the No. 28 pick, it won’t necessarily be involved in or related to a Ben Simmons trade, according to Neubeck, who says nothing much has changed on that front.

Philadelphia continues to set a high asking price in discussions involving Simmons and isn’t interested in trading him for a package made up of role players and draft assets. For instance, Neubeck says the Sixers wouldn’t be interested in dealing with the Kings if De’Aaron Fox wasn’t included in Sacramento’s offer. If the 76ers stick to that stance, it’s probably safe to assume Simmons won’t be a King.
